    fix ITER_PIPE interaction with direct_IO · c3a69024
    Al Viro authored
    
    
    by making sure we call iov_iter_advance() on original
    iov_iter even if direct_IO (done on its copy) has returned 0.
    It's a no-op for old iov_iter flavours and does the right thing
    (== truncation of the stuff we'd allocated, but not filled) in
    ITER_PIPE case.  Failures (e.g. -EIO) get caught and dealt with
    by cleanup in generic_file_read_iter().
